There are fewer in-season produce selections in winter (naturally!) but the bright side of eating in-season is that you won't ever get tired of fresh tomatoes and peaches! Here are common fruits and vegetables that are either coming into harvest in winter or still available in winter.

In Season Fruits and Vegetables: Winter
- FRUITS
- Grapefruit
- Kiwis
- Lemons
- Mandarins / Clementines
- Oranges
- Pears
- Tangerines
- VEGETABLES
- Beets
- Brussels sprouts
- Cabbage
- Cauliflower
- Chicories: Belgian Endive, Curly Endive, Escarole, Raddichio
- Fennel
- Kale
- Leeks
- Parsnips
- Radishes
- Sweet potatoes
- Turnips
- Winter squash
